Hockey Canada has unveiled its rosters for the upcoming Olympics orientation camp, featuring a host of prominent players aiming to secure a spot on the national team. Among the standout names are Connor McDavid and Sidney Crosby, who have consistently showcased their exceptional skills on the ice. The camp is set to be a platform for these elite athletes to demonstrate their readiness for international competition, and it promises to be an exhilarating showcase of hockey talent.

In addition to McDavid and Crosby, the roster includes powerhouse players like Nathan MacKinnon and Brayden Point, both of whom have proven their mettle in the NHL. The camp will not only focus on established stars but also the potential future sensations that could make their mark at the Olympics, highlighting Hockey Canada's depth in talent.
